WebSep 23, 2024 · Prince Henry (Henrique) the Navigator (1394-1460) was a Portuguese royal prince, soldier, and patron of explorers. Henry sent many sailing expeditions down Africa’s … WebOct 6, 2014 · Henry the Navigator became an explorer to find the source of the gold trade in West Africa. He also wanted to find the kingdom of Prester John. Another aim was the …

Prince Henry the Navigator provided the 3 T's that spurred on the Age of Exploration: training for sailors and captains, development of navigational tools, and provided the treasury by financing many voyages to search for an all-water route to the Indies. WebPrince Henry of Portugal is also known as Prince Henry the Navigator. Although he was not an explorer himself, he did ignite the interests in Portuguese exploration and even funding the expeditions.
